可验证的同步路线:面向高可用与安全管控的TP钱包同步框架

在TP钱包中实现可靠同步既是用户体验的核心,也是钱包安全与合规的第一道防线。本文以专业评估报告的视角,提出一套可执行的同步流程与技术框架,重点兼顾Golang实现细节、权限监控、故障注入防护与面向未来的数字化扩展。流程上,先在安全沙箱中

完成密钥导入与完整性校验(助记词/私钥/硬件签名),随后通过轻客户端或RPC节点建立链头同步:1)初

始化网络连接与链ID验证;2)分段下载区块头并并行验证Merkle根与签名;3)按账户索引做状态重建与交易重扫;4)完成后做差异对账与本地数据库持久化;5)启动持续增量同步与回滚策略。Golang实现建议使用模块化设计,采用go-ethereum或轻量客户端库,利用goroutine池、context超时与chhttps://www.gzquanshi.com ,annel背压保证并发稳定;网络层选用gRPC/JSON-RPC双轨模式以兼顾效率与兼容。权限监控应在系统与应用层并重:基于最小权限原则实现进程隔离、文件系统加密与细粒度RPC许可;结合实时审计日志、行为异常检测与策略引擎完成告警闭环。防故障注入策略包括输入校验、签名与序列号防重放、熔断器与速率限制、Chaos测试及硬件安全模块的根信任链,必要时采用证据保全与回溯分析机制。面向未来的数字化发展,应预留跨链索引、去中心化身份(DID)与可编排的合约事件流接口,并把数据分层存储与流式处理作为高效能平台基石。评估结论:通过Golang的高并发能力、严密的权限与审计体系、以及系统化的故障注入防护,TP钱包的同步机制可在安全性、可用性与可扩展性之间取得平衡。实施建议包括阶段性灰度部署、第三方安全测评与持续性能基准测试,以确保在数字化演进中保持可验证、可控与高效的同步服务。

作者:李亦辰发布时间:2025-12-04 18:14:51

评论

小墨

技术路线清晰,尤其认可Golang并发方案和权限审计的结合。

TechJane

建议补充对轻客户端与全节点在性能与信任模型上的权衡分析。

张博

防故障注入部分实用,能否给出chaos测试的具体场景?

CryptoKid

语言通俗又专业,期待更多跨链与DID的实现细节。

相关阅读